You may find this helpful, according to the Sermon Chakras: More InformationExternal ↗ by High Priestess Lydia Coventina, the Ajna (6th) chakra in a state of Sattva (the ideal state) produces:
Feeling connected to intuition. Using your visualization to manifest your magick into reality. Insightful dreams and psychic communication. Seeing things as they are, not influenced by illusion or false beliefs. Having a healthy understanding of your emotional state.
Besides the spiritual practices, you can also improve this chakra by noting the following:
How to improve this chakra: Meditation, specifically awareness, mindfulness, void meditations. Strengthening your ability to focus. Get off the computer/phone/social media and into nature. Read a textbook instead of watching quick "information dump" videos. Journaling.
